Skip to main content
SS
Open to opportunities

Samuel Schneider

@samuelschneider

I build scalable full-stack language and security analytics systems using compiler tech, static analysis, and CI-driven testing.

United States
Message

What I'm looking for

I’m looking for a team where I can build language frontends and static-analysis pipelines end-to-end—partnering with security and ML—while shipping reliable production systems with strong CI, testing discipline, and developer-focused documentation.

I’m a Senior Full Stack Engineer with 10+ years building scalable web platforms, developer tooling, and AI-enabled analytics systems. My recent work focuses on language frontend development and program-analysis pipelines for automated vulnerability detection, with a strong emphasis on compiler and parser integration.

In my latest role, I led the design and implementation of 5 language frontends and parser integrations, improving analysis coverage by 48%. I translated compiler semantic models and Roslyn syntax trees into Joern Code Property Graphs (CPG), boosting CPG fidelity for method and type information by 92%, and delivered a framework processing 1M+ source files while reducing translation latency by 33%. I also maintained 200+ integration tests and CI pipelines, decreasing regressions by 60%, and containerized parser services to handle 5x peak analysis load. I collaborate closely with distributed teams and open source contributors, triaging parser issues, submitting 30+ PRs, and coordinating releases with thorough documentation and release notes.

Experience

Work history, roles, and key accomplishments

VM

Senior Software Engineer

Visible Magic

Jan 2020 - Sep 2020 (8 months)

Implemented backend language-processing components and parser integrations for analytics platforms, building 3 parser adapters using ANTLR and tree-sitter. Developed Roslyn-based C# analysis and .NET Core/Java REST microservices, reducing data transfer overhead by 35% and improving token-level accuracy by 27%.

BG

Software Engineer

Big Machine Label Group

May 2016 - Nov 2019 (3 years 6 months)

Developed Python and Java backend services and parser-driven ETL pipelines, processing 10M+ records per month. Implemented ANTLR-based parsing to extract business rules and integrated static analysis/ML signals, increasing automation coverage by 42% and actionable insights by 22%.

CA

Junior Software Developer

Cogent Analytics

May 2015 - Apr 2016 (11 months)

Supported full stack analytics and code-processing tools for 15+ consulting clients, contributing parser utilities and data extraction components. Built ETL/reporting services and parsing modules, improving reporting timeliness from weekly to daily and increasing release confidence by reducing post-release issues by 33%.

Education

Degrees, certifications, and relevant coursework

East Carolina University logoEU

East Carolina University

Bachelor of Science (BS), Criminal Justice

2010 - 2014

Earned a Bachelor of Science (BS) in Criminal Justice from East Carolina University from 2010 to 2014.

Find your dream job

Sign up now and join over 250,000+ rem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an